When can you knock in scat?

If at the start of your turn, you believe that your hand value is at least as high as your opponents can achieve with one more turn, you can knock instead of drawing a card. Knocking ends your turn; you must keep the hand you had at the start of that turn, but each other player gets one final turn to draw and discard.

How many decks do you need for 31?

Thirty-one uses a standard deck of 52 playing cards (in the Dutch version - Eenendertigen - only 32 cards - 7 and higher - are used). Aces are high, counting 11, court cards count 10, and all other cards count face value. Each player gets a hand of three cards, and three pennies as their "lives".

What happens if you knock in scat and lose?

If you knock and lose, having the sole lowest hand, you pay two pennies (if you have that many). If someone declares 31, all the other players have to put a penny in the kitty. If someone declares 31 after another player has knocked, the knocker just pays one penny, like everyone else.

What happens if you knock in 31 and lose?

Rules. If a player has a hand value of 31, the cards are immediately shown and every other player loses a life. If the player that knocks ends up with the lowest hand value, he/she loses two lives.
